A timing chain is one of the most critical components in your BMW’s engine. It synchronises the rotation of the crankshaft and camshaft, ensuring that your engine’s valves open and close at precisely the right moments. BMW timing chain replacement becomes necessary when the chain stretches, breaks, or shows signs of wear that could cause serious engine damage. In Mackay, we’ve seen plenty of BMWs come through with timing chain issues, and catching the problem early makes all the difference between a straightforward repair and a catastrophic engine failure.

Signs Your BMW Timing Chain Needs Attention

Your BMW will usually give you warning signs before a timing chain fails completely. The most common symptoms include a rattling noise from the front of the engine, especially when you start the car or accelerate. Some drivers describe it as a metallic clattering that gets louder when the engine is cold. You might also notice rough idle, a check engine light on your dashboard, or difficulty starting the vehicle. In some cases, you’ll smell fuel or notice white smoke from the exhaust, which can indicate the engine is running out of time due to poor valve synchronisation.

BMW models use either a timing chain or timing belt depending on the generation, but chains are designed to last the life of the engine in theory. In practice, especially on higher-mileage vehicles or those that haven’t had regular oil changes, the chain can stretch and wear. If you’ve noticed any of these symptoms, don’t delay getting your BMW checked. A stretched or worn timing chain can slip on its sprockets, throwing off your engine timing and causing misfires or even internal engine damage.

How We Diagnose and Replace a BMW Timing Chain

We start with a full diagnostic using our Snap-On equipment to scan your BMW’s engine codes and read the timing parameters. This tells us exactly what’s happening before we even open up the engine. We’ll listen for the telltale rattle and check your service history to understand how the chain has been treated. Many timing chain issues are linked to poor oil changes or using non-approved oil grades, so we’ll review that too.

The actual replacement process is thorough. We remove the necessary covers and components to access the timing chain, then carefully replace the chain, sprockets, and tensioners with genuine BMW or OEM-specification parts. This isn’t a job where you cut corners with cheap aftermarket components. Your BMW’s precision engineering demands parts that meet its exact specifications. We also replace the seals and gaskets we disturb during the work, so you don’t develop leaks down the track.

Throughout the replacement, we check the overall condition of the engine bay. A timing chain job is an opportunity to inspect other critical systems like your water pump, belts, and pulleys. If we spot anything that needs attention, we’ll let you know upfront with a transparent quote before we proceed.

What Affects the Cost and Time for BMW Timing Chain Replacement in Mackay

Several factors influence how long a timing chain replacement takes and what you’ll invest in the repair. The specific BMW model and generation matters significantly. Some models have the timing chain more accessible than others, which changes labour time. An older 3 Series will have a different layout than a newer X5, for example.

Parts availability is another factor. Genuine BMW timing chain kits are usually in stock or available quickly, but if there’s a supply chain delay, that affects your turnaround time. We use genuine or OEM-equivalent parts, not budget substitutes, because a cheaper chain will fail again and cost you far more in the long run. We’ll always discuss parts options and pricing transparently before we start work.

The severity of the wear also matters. If the chain has already slipped and caused internal timing issues, we may need to do additional work to restore proper engine operation. This is exactly why our initial diagnostic is so important. We’ll identify the full scope of work needed, so there are no surprises.

Driving on a worn or failing timing chain is risky. As the chain stretches or deteriorates, engine timing becomes inaccurate, which can damage pistons, valves, and other internal components. A complete chain failure leaves you stranded and can cost significantly more to repair. If you’ve noticed symptoms, have it inspected before continuing to drive regularly.
